Preview: Besiktas vs. Adana Demirspor - prediction, team news, lineups

sportsmole.co.uk, 19 September 2021, 21:13
Current Super Lig champions Besiktas will welcome Adana Demirspor on Tuesday, looking to build on an impressive start that has seen them collect 13 points from their first five league games.

In contrast to their opponents, Adana Demirspor have struggled early on in the season, picking up just five points from their opening fixtures.

Match preview

Besiktas have been imperious early on in the league season, winning four out of five games, and they are still yet to lose in the Super Lig this campaign.

The reigning Turkish champions have been in fine goalscoring touch, netting on 10 occasions in the league and they only conceded their first Super Lig goals of the season on Saturday, when they emerged victorious against Antalyaspor courtesy of a 3-2 scoreline.

They mounted an incredible comeback in that fixture, after going into half time 2-0 down, but three goals in the second period from Ridvan Yilmaz, Michy Batshuayi and Rachid Ghezzal ensured they prolonged their unbeaten league start.

Besiktas have been superb at home, with their only defeat at Vodafone Park this campaign coming in the Champions League against Borussia Dortmund.

In the league they have won their three fixtures at home with relative ease, scoring seven times across those fixtures, and they are still yet to concede at Vodafone Park in the Super Lig this term, which will mean they head into Tuesday's clash full of confidence.

Adana Demirspor have started slowly on their return to the top flight after earning promotion last season, but they will be buoyant after picking up their first win of the season on Saturday.

A Mario Balotelli penalty and goals from Matias Vargas and Birkir Bjarnason led Adana Demirspor to a 3-1 victory over Rizespor, which ensured they clinched their first three points of the campaign.

A concern for head coach Vincenzo Montella is that they have only earned one point from their two away games, and in those fixtures, they have only managed to score once, whilst conceding five times.

The away side are enjoying their first appearance in the top flight since the 1994-95 season, so league fixtures between the two have been few and far between, but the teams last faced each other in a competitive match in 2015, when Besiktas thrashed Adana Demirspor 4-1 in the Turkish Cup.

Adana Demirspor will be aiming to better the 3-0 defeat they suffered the last time they travelled to Besiktas in the Super Lig back in September 1994.

Team News

Besiktas are still without midfielder Alex Teixeira and defender Domagoj Vida who are both out injured.

Ajdin Hasic is also still unavailable and is a long-term absentee, while Welinton is out after picking up an injury against Borussia Dortmund.

Head coach Sergen Yalcin will also be without Necip Uysal and Mehmet Topal as the pair were forced off in the first half against Antalyaspor.

Adana Demirspor are without David Akintola and Younes Belhanda, who are both out injured for the away side.

The visitors are looking for two consecutive victories, and Montella could name the same team that started the match against Rizespor.

We say: Besiktas 2-1 Adana Demirspor

Besiktas have some injury concerns in defence, so they may not be as secure as they usually are, but they still possess quality in the final third, and should have enough to pick up the three points against Adana Demirspor.
